Is $108,000 a good salary in New Brunswick?
Yes — $108,000 is an excellent salary for New Brunswick. It puts you around the 91st income percentile — the top 9% of earners — with about $74,700 in take-home pay after tax, CPP and EI.

Your paycheque
Where your $108,000 goes
Estimated 2026 deductions for a New Brunswick resident, employment income.
Take-home pay
$74,700
Federal tax
$16,033
Provincial tax + health
$11,497
CPP + CPP2
$4,646
EI
$1,123
Average tax rate ≈ 25.5% · Total deductions ≈ 30.8% · Marginal ≈ 36.5%
